Industries and authorities are making efforts to improve turbofan engine’s reliability. Service history could provide good in-sight of the engine’s behavior. Based on service experiences of certain turbofan engine for decades, the IFSD (In-Flight-Shutdown) rate is calculated to every period of engine life. With this data, statistical hypothesis tests were conducted. The results can’t reject a hypothesis of same average IFSD rate between early stage and late stage in engine life. Both subgroups of new engines and overhauled engines are considered in this analysis.
